FRONT
SIDE IMPACT SENSOR
•
|
Removal of the airbag must be
performed according to the precautions/procedures described
previously. |
•
|
Before disconnecting the side impact
sensor connector(s), disconnect the side airbag
connector(s). |
•
|
Do not turn the ignition switch ON and
do not connect the battery cable while replacing the side
impact
sensor. | |
1. |
Disconnect the battery negative cable, and
wait for at least three minutes before beginning
work. |
2. |
Remove the lower anchor
bolt. |
3. |
Remove the door scuff trim. (Refer to BD
group) |
4. |
Remove the center pillar trim. (Refer to BD
group) |
5. |
Disconnect the Side Impact Sensor connector
and remove the Side Impact Sensor mounting bolt.

|
REAR
SIDE IMPACT SENSOR
1. |
Disconnect the battery negative cable and
wait for at least three minutes before beginning
work. |
2. |
Remove the rear seat. (Refer to BD
group) |
3. |
Remove the Luggage side trim. (Refer to BD
group) |
4. |
Disconnect the side impact sensor
connector. |
5. |
Loosen the side impact sensor mounting bolt
and remove the side impact sensor.

|
FRONT
SIDE IMPACT SENSOR
•
|
Do not turn the ignition switch ON and
do not connect the battery cable while replacing the side
impact
sensor. | |
1. |
Install the new Side Impact Sensor with the
bolt then connect the SRS harness connector to the Side Impact
Sensor.
Tightening torque
: 1.0 ~ 1.4 kgf.m (9.5 ~ 13.5 Nm, 7.0
~ 10.0 lb.ft)
| |
2. |
Install the center pillar trim. (Refer to BD
group) |
3. |
Install the door scuff trim. (Refer to BD
group) |
4. |
Install the lower anchor
bolts. |
5. |
Reconnect the battery negative
cable. |
6. |
After installing the Side Impact Sensor,
confirm proper system operation: Turn the ignition switch ON, the
SRS indicator light should be turned on for about six seconds and
then go off. |
REAR
SIDE IMPACT SENSOR
•
|
Do not turn the ignition switch ON and
do not connect the battery cable while replacing the side
impact
sensor. | |
1. |
Install the new Side Impact Sensor with the
bolt then connect the SRS harness connector to the Side Impact
Sensor.
Tightening torque
: 1.0 ~ 1.4 kgf.m (9.5 ~ 13.5 Nm, 7.0
~ 10.0 lb.ft)
| |
2. |
Install the Luggage side trim. (Refer to BD
group) |
3. |
Install the rear seat. (Refer to BD
group) |
4. |
Reconnect the battery negative
cable. |
5. |
After installing the Side Impact Sensor,
confirm proper system operation: Turn the ignition switch ON, the
SRS indicator light should be turned on for about six seconds and
then go
off. | |
